We’re all familiar with Dr. Seuss’ story of that fateful rainy day when the Cat in the Hat came to play. Chaos, mayhem, Thing One and Thing Two getting everyone in trouble—it was insanity. Now, thanks to Wonder Forge, kids can bring the story of that day to life with the Dr. Seuss Thing Two and Thing One Whirly Fun! Game.

Players take turns drawing from the stack of cards, some of which let the player pick up all the objects of one color to quickly clean up the messy house. (Bonus: Kids are learning about colors and shapes with these object cards. Hooray for hidden learning!) If a player draws a Mom card, they must then move the Mom game piece one space closer to the door. As they race to clean up the chaos, a player might draw a Thing One or Thing Two card and the real mayhem begins. Players must spin the top and watch it fly through the house, causing a new mess.

The gameboard is absolutely adorable. This pop-up house is easy to set up and provides a different aesthetic than a typical tabletop board game. It features nostalgic illustrations from the original Cat in the Hat book that both new fans and older generations will adore. Each piece of the game is brightly colored, ensuring all of the Seuss-tastic fun.

The best part of this game is the element of cooperative play. Players must work together to get the house cleaned up before Mom gets home. Every game closet should have a couple of cooperative play games for younger kids. While competitive games have tons of benefits in themselves—learning healthy competition, etc.—cooperative games teach kids a whole different skill set. When kids are playing together to achieve a goal, the focus is more on teamwork, supporting each other, and learning how to work as a group.
